Job Description
Job Details
- Company Name: Lorven Technologies
- Employment type: Part time
- Experience: 4 yearsÂ
- Salary: $30 to $48 Hourly
- Location : Remote Option Available
- Work schedule : 5 days a week
Job Overview
We are looking for an experienced Senior Backend Developer with strong expertise in Node.js and Azure cloud environments to build and maintain scalable, secure server-side applications. This role requires hands-on backend development experience, strong cloud deployment knowledge, and the ability to collaborate effectively across multiple cross-functional teams.
The ideal candidate is technically strong, highly motivated, and comfortable working on complex systems in a fast-changing environment.
Required Qualifications
- 6+ years of professional software development experience, including work on complex projects involving multiple cross-functional teams.
- 4+ years of hands-on experience developing server-side APIs using Node.js on Linux environments.
- Strong experience deploying, managing, and operating Node.js applications on Microsoft Azure.
- Familiarity with cloud-native deployment infrastructure (CI/CD, scaling, monitoring, etc.).
- Experience with relational and/or document-based databases.
- Knowledge of security and authentication protocols such as OAuth 2.0 and OpenID Connect (OIDC) is preferred.
Key Responsibilities
- Design, develop, and maintain server-side APIs using Node.js.
- Deploy and manage backend services in Azure cloud environments.
- Collaborate with product managers, frontend developers, and other stakeholders to deliver robust solutions.
- Ensure application security, scalability, and reliability.
- Troubleshoot and resolve backend and deployment-related issues.
- Contribute to architectural discussions and technical decision-making
Secondary (Non-Development) Skills
- Highly motivated, self-directed, and execution-focused.
- Strong critical thinking skills with the ability to analyze beyond surface-level requirements.
- Detail-oriented while maintaining awareness of broader business and system impacts.
- Ability to adapt quickly to changing priorities and requirements.
- Capable of managing multiple tasks and deliverables in an organized, results-driven manner.
- Proactively identifies opportunities to improve business process efficiency and effectiveness.
- Excellent written and verbal communication skills.
- Strong analytical and quantitative mindset.
- Strong interpersonal skills with the ability to collaborate across all levels of the organization.
Nice-to-Have Skills
- Experience with advanced Azure services and monitoring tools.
- Exposure to DevOps practices and CI/CD pipelines.
- Experience working in highly regulated or enterprise environments.